Attention 8th-11th grade students: FEMA created the Youth Preparedness Council in 2012 to bring together young leaders from across the country who are interested in supporting disaster preparedness nationally and locally. The YPC offers an opportunity for teens with a passion for preparedness to engage with FEMA to share ideas and feedback, grow their leadership skills, and support resilience in their communities through preparedness projects. They participate in an annual virtual summit with FEMA leaders and preparedness professionals to network and learn more about the field. The 2022 application period is now open.
